Job description-Registered Behavior Technician (RBT)
Job Summary
We are seeking a compassionate and dedicated Registered Behavior Technician (RBT) to join our team. The RBT will work under the supervision of a Board Certified Behavior Analyst (BCBA) to implement individualized behavior intervention plans for clients, primarily focusing on children with developmental disabilities. This role is crucial in supporting clients in achieving their behavioral goals and improving their overall quality of life.

Registered Behavior Technician (RBT) Duties
Implement behavior intervention plans as designed by the supervising BCBA.
Collect and record data on client behaviors and progress towards goals.
Assist in developing care plans tailored to individual needs.
Educate clients and their families about behavioral strategies and interventions.
Maintain accurate medical records and documentation in compliance with HIPAA regulations.
Collaborate with other professionals involved in the client's care to ensure a cohesive approach.
Provide support during therapy sessions, ensuring a safe and encouraging environment for clients.
Participate in ongoing training and professional development to enhance skills in behavioral therapy.
